Another star emerges

In what has been a whirlwind 12 months for Deep Woods Estate, yet another star has emerged from the portfolio. Late last week, the 2015 Deep Woods Estate Cabernet Merlot was awarded a trophy and gold medal at the National Wine Show of Australia and another gold medal at the Royal Hobart Wine Show. This brings the total for the 2015 wine to six Trophies and seven Gold Medals and caps off a remarkable run of success for the wine.

 

The National Wine Show of Australia is an invite-only wine competition held in Canberra each November and is considered by many to provide a ‘best of the best’ snapshot of the Australian Wine Industry. Wineries are only invited to submit a wine upon receipt of a trophy at one of the capital city wine shows in the preceding 12 months.

 

Deep Woods Estate Chief Winemaker Julian Langworthy was understandably wrapt with the result. “It’s always both exciting and humbling to be awarded a trophy at a major wine show, even more so at the National Wine Show. The Cabernet Sauvignon program at Deep Woods continues to shine and the success of this wine validates our firm belief that the Yallingup sub-region of Margaret River produces the best Cabernet in Australia”

 

The Deep Woods Estate Cabernet Merlot is no stranger to awards, the 2014 vintage was awarded two trophies and four gold medals and the 2013 vintage was awarded three gold medals.
